Handover for Vexport cold storage archival. Buckets older than 18 months in the Dravenmoor region move to glacier tier Friday. Script is staged; dry run passed. Two buckets (orcherd-logs, orcherd-media) have legal holds — skip them. Release manager signs off before the cutover window; don't start without that. If the archival job stalls mid-transfer, kill it and restart from the manifest, not from scratch. Unlocking the archive vault for the restart requires the recovery passphrase noted below.

strongbox words: norwyn-wenael-aldvan-aldiel-wendor-holael

Subject: Handover — export retry pipeline

Hi all,

Passing the release baton for the Cartmule export service this cycle. Plugin authors: the new retry behavior (exponential backoff, max 5 attempts, dead-letter after that) lands in 3.1, so make sure your failure callbacks are idempotent — retries will re-invoke them. If your plugin pushes export artifacts to the retry queue, they now need to be signed or the worker skips them. Sorry for the short notice. Sign your artifacts with the key below.

deploy key for kajof-fajop: bky6_gDHw9Q

## Session Handling for Health Checks

The Corvel gateway sits behind the Lanternside load balancer, which probes /healthz every ten seconds. Health-check requests are stateless by design: they bypass the session store entirely so that probe traffic never inflates session counts or evicts real user sessions. New team members should note that the deep-check endpoint, /healthz/deep, does verify session-store connectivity and therefore requires authentication. When probing it manually, supply the token below.

bearer token for tajep-kajef: eyJhbGciOiJIUzI1NiIsInR5cCI6IkpXVCJ9.eyJzdWIiOiIoOsZ23In0.CsygO0hs

## Tuning

After the 4.2 upgrade of the Quillbase engine, the planner began preferring sequential scans on the audit tables, which materially increased query latency and, more importantly for review purposes, widened the window during which audit rows are unindexed and harder to verify. We mitigated this by pinning planner cost parameters rather than patching the engine, keeping the change auditable and reversible. The pinned values, applied at session start, are shown below.

tuning constants:
QUOTAS = {
    "druwyn": 5,
    "holix": 5,
    "zorath": 5,
    "holwyn": 10,
}